Agreement to improve the quality of working life for employees of La Poste

The management of the French postal group, La Poste, and four trade union organisations signed a framework agreement on the quality of working life on 22 January 2013. The deal builds on the report drawn up in September 2012 by a group of experts and social partners set up after several cases of suicide took place among the company's employees.
The framework agreement on the quality of working life ("Accord-cadre sur la qualité de vie au travail à La Poste" - in French), concluded by the management of La Poste (276,000 employees in 2010) and four trade union organisations representing 48% of votes at the last workplace elections in October 2011, comprises both immediate measures and commitments concerning the commencement of future negotiations. As well as its content, what is interesting about this agreement is the way in which it had been reached. An analyze will be published soon by Eurofound.
